There are 184 countries around the world petitioning for the US embargo on Cuba to end.

It isn’t a political matter as much as it is a humanitarian one.

The UN has passed resolutions for *29 years in a row* demanding that the US ends the blockade on international legal and humanitarian grounds.

At the last vote Israel and the US voted against, three countries abstained, and every other UN-recognised country in the world voted for.
